The Massey Ferguson 2745 is a row-crop tractor produced from 1978 to 1983 as part of the 2000 Series. It features a Perkins 8.8L 8-cylinder diesel engine with direct injection and liquid cooling. The tractor offers a choice of transmissions including a 24-speed 3-speed power shift and an 8-speed mechanical shuttle. It has a PTO power of 140 hp claimed and tested PTO power of 143.4 hp. The tractor is two-wheel drive with hydrostatic power steering and hydraulic wet disc brakes. It comes standard with a cab with air-conditioning or an available platform with four-post ROPS. The Massey Ferguson 2745 supports a rear Type II hitch with position control and lower-link draft sensing, and an independent rear PTO with hydraulic clutch. Dimensions include a 110 inch wheelbase, length of 181.6 inches, and various tire and tread options. The tractor weighs between 12,500 and 15,190 lbs operating weight, with ballasted weight up to 19,490 lbs. Electrical system features a 12-volt battery and 58 amp alternator. Attachments include a 246 front-end loader with up to 4500 lbs lift capacity and multiple bucket widths.
